Avs now playoff bound

via Denver Post:

The Avalanche knew three things after Peter Forsberg’s first goal of the season punctuated a rally that gave Colorado a 4-2 victory over the Vancouver Canucks on Tuesday night at GM Place:

One, Colorado will be back in the NHL playoffs after a one-season absence;

Two, the Avs will finish no lower than seventh in the Western Conference standings, meaning they won’t face the Detroit Red Wings in the first round;

And three, the teasing relationship between Avalanche captain Joe Sakic and Forsberg, who beat Canucks goalie Roberto Luongo on a breakaway to give Colorado a two-goal lead at 4:53 of the third period, has been re-established.

“Joe asked me if I wanted the puck,” Forsberg said with a smile in the noisy Avalanche dressing room. “At first I had to think about it, but it’s OK. I don’t think I should keep that one. But it was definitely great to get a goal.”
